According to the vociferous football administrator, Mr Asiamah has done nothing to help enhance sports in the country, but more especially football.
“Isaac Asiamah has been sleeping for a longer period now and he must wake up because our sports, especially football, is deteriorating. A meeting with the GFA members over several incidents that hamper the growth of the league could have helped," Gruzah told Happy FM.
“He should be a father when it comes to sports and help all federations settle such matters. This is the third season we have an injunction on the league and it is becoming a norm in our football."
The Ghana Premier League, which was supposed to commence on Friday, February 9, was indefinitely called off following a court injunction by Great Olympics last Monday.
